We are currently looking for a highly skilled, caring, and safety focused individual for our Buttcon West team. The Project Coordinator will assist and support the Project Manager(s) on the project. The Project Coordinator will be responsible for all coordinating duties and assist with the project administrative processes.
Come be a part of our growing team and experience the satisfaction of “Transforming Visions into Buildings”.
ResponsibilityHere’s What You’ll be Responsible for:
- Maintain excellent relationships with owners, architects, consultants, trades, and the public.
- Ensure compliance with Buttcon’s Health and Safety Program and Buttcon’s Policy and Procedures Manual.
- Assist the project team to adhere to the timelines and deliverables.
- Understand the contract documents
- Track, and process all submittals (shop drawings, product data, samples, inspection reports closeout documents etc.).
- Track and process all RFI’s, and SI’s.
- Track, price and process all Change Events and ensure the Project Manager has reviewed the Change Event before submission to the Owner and/or Consultant.
- Record, track, and process all construction drawings.
- Process all Change Orders and Contract Revision for approval by the Project Manager.
- Provide innovative solutions to issues that may arise during the project.
- Manage day-to-day activities for the Project Management team.
- Utilize Buttcon’s Project Management software, to complete all project administration.
- Prepare close-out documentations, including O&M manuals, warranties, and archive project records with the assistance of the Project Closeout Coordinator.
- Coordinate warranty work with the Project Team.
- Assist in securing new work by participating in pre-tender site meetings, receiving quotations from trades during a bid closing, delivering tenders, and participating in proposals and presentations.
- Supervise, mentor, coach, and train other project personnel, when applicable.
- Monitor and provide feedback on subtrade performance.
- Any other duties as assigned.
